Announcements:
1. Please don't store the batteries for a long time, it need to be used at least once a month.
2. If it's necessary, please using a cotton swab with alcohol to clean the battery contacts.
3. After long-time using in your power tools, please fully rest the batteries.
4. Before recharging the batteries, please make sure that the batteries have already coolled down.
5. For safe transportation, the batteries have not been full charged, after three cycles (full charge and full discharge for three times), the batteries can reach the best condition.
6. When your power tools are stucking and unable to run, please don't force it to run. Otherwise excessive current will burn down the batteries. The right way is that pulling the tools back and running the tools again smoothly.
